Check the rollback_segments value in your init<SID>.ora file. For example, it shoud be set to = (r01,r02,r03,r04) if you have all these four non-system rollback segments.

: I am finishing up getting a new system online.
: The old Oracle system was v7.0.16 and the new system is v8.0.5

: The problem I am having is whenever I have to reboot the new system
: (machine reboot) and then try to insert rows into Oracle, I get the
: following error message:

: ORA-01552: cannot use system rollback segment for non-system
: tablespace 'TELETRADE_DATA'

: I then have to run a script to recreate my rollback segments, and then
: inserts work properly. My question is what am I missing in the Oracle
: startup files? As far as I can tell, I duplicated the startup scripts
: from our older system running v7 (which works just fine). Was there a
: change from v7 to v8 that might affect this?

: Can anyone point me in the right direction?
